My Father Cigars Announces La Lealtad

April 4, 2026 By Matthew Tabacco

Earlier this week, My Father Cigars announced a new cigar called La Lealtad that is set to debut at PCA 2026. While the company has not revealed many details on this, it is said to be the second cigar to come from the company’s new Honduran factory after the release of latest year’s My Father Blue.

The name is the Spanish word for “loyalty” and in a social media post where it was revealed, the company wrote, “where legacy starts with loyalty and tradition”.

The box featured in the video posted to social media shows the size being a 6 x 54 toro, but Smokin Tabacco was told there are four sizes and was also confirmed to be a regular production. More on this release when we have more information.
